Biography
Pierre Soulé (died 1870) was an American politician who represented Louisiana in the United States Senate across 2 separate periods of service between 1847 and 1853, between the 29th and 33rd Congresses. Soulé served as a Democrat. Soulé died on March 26, 1870.
